Yoho National Park Visitor Centre is located just off the Trans-Canada Highway, 83km (51 miles) northwest of Banff (P.O. Box 99, Field, BC V0A 1G0; tel. 250/343-6783; www.pc.gc.ca), and is open daily 9am to 4pm.

Kootenay National Park Visitor Centre, 7556 Main St. E., Radium Hot Springs, BC V0A 1M0 (tel. 250/347-9505; www.pc.gc.ca), is 134km (83 miles) southwest of Banff, but you drive through the park to get to the Visitor Centre, which is open daily 9am to 5pm.

Mount Robson Provincial Park (tel. 250/566-4325) is just across the Alberta and British Columbia border from Jasper and is open May through September daily 7am to 11pm.

Fees -- Admission to Banff, Jasper, Yoho, and Kootenay parks costs C$9.80 adult, C$8.30 seniors, C$4.90 youths 6-16, or C$19.60 families per day.
